To many A Perfect Circle fans, the fact that Maynard James Keenan, Billy Howerdel, and the bunch are back together touring is a bonus — two years ago, there was no convincing evidence the band would bother, what with MJK’s other commitments. Now that they are touring, as with Rage Against the Machine or Soundgarden, the question of course has been whether anything will come of it.
Guitarist Howerdel has sort of answered that question. Speaking with Rocknewsdesk.com, he intimated, Were going to have at least one new song on the tour. Its very close to being done, and from there, things could come together. Once were on the road and start hashing through our ideas, they could quickly become a song and make it onto the stage.”
Howerdel continued, So theres an album in the works, but not for this summer. The idea was to get the juices flowing a bit and get back into A Perfect Circle mode, and go from there. But we do intend to record new material.
The “quickly become a song” bit sounds a little suspect, but if the process works for them, who are we to judge? Stay tuned, at least until August when the current run of dates is over.
